Output 13bbaf974be33660a8369c75af4d237f48fb555f29d417626fe1b9ffb1aac83e:0

value
76233720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12752c52d98b027bc078ffd52d8efe823c115129 OP_EQUAL
address
33NcTL3UfzBQb3cN2KYQ9pwcVNjqwPCk4F
transaction
13bbaf974be33660a8369c75af4d237f48fb555f29d417626fe1b9ffb1aac83e
spent
true